Calvin B. Harley is a scholar working on Physiology, Molecular Biology and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Calvin B. Harley has authored 107 papers receiving a total of 32.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 75 papers in Physiology, 56 papers in Molecular Biology and 17 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Calvin B. Harley’s work include Telomeres, Telomerase, and Senescence (69 papers), Genetics, Aging, and Longevity in Model Organisms (17 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(15 papers). Calvin B. Harley is often cited by papers focused on Telomeres, Telomerase, and Senescence (69 papers), Genetics, Aging, and Longevity in Model Organisms (17 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(15 papers). Calvin B. Harley coll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and United Kingdom. Calvin B. Harley's co-authors include Carol W. Greider, A. B. Futcher, Woodring E. Wright, Jerry W. Shay, Scott L. Weinrich, Richard Allsopp, Michael D. West, Gregg B. Morin, Nam W. Kim and Mieczyslaw A. Piatyszek and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
